dolorouscausing or expressing grief, sorrow, or pain

Part of speech: ADJECTIVE

Definition: causing or expressing grief, sorrow, or pain

Pronunciation (IPA): /ˈdoʊlərəs/

Korean meaning: 슬픔이나 고통을 일으키거나 표현하는

Korean pronunciation: **돌**러러스

Example Sentences

  • His dolorous breakup songs made everyone at the karaoke bar cry into their beer.
  • The dolorous howling of my neighbor's dog at 3 AM is becoming a serious problem.
  • The dolorous melody of the old piano reminded her of happier times.

🌳Etymology

Rootdolor
Suffix--ous

Origin

From Latin 'dolorosus' meaning 'full of pain or grief,' derived from 'dolor' meaning 'pain' or 'sorrow.'
